Cement-Free Concrete: A Revolutionary Alternative

The construction sector is constantly exploring sustainable alternatives to traditional concrete, and binderless concrete is rising as a viable option. This advanced material substitutes Portland cement, the primary ingredient, with industrial materials like slag , creating a strong concrete mix with a considerably reduced ecological effect. Preliminary research suggests that cement-free concrete can provide similar performance while tackling concerns about cement production's environmental costs .

Green CO2 Cement in India : Tackling the Climate Crisis

The growing construction sector in the country significantly contributes to global carbon emissions, primarily due to conventional cement production. Recognizing this, there's a accelerating focus on reduced-carbon concrete alternatives. These novel solutions involve replacing cement with supplementary materials like slag , employing carbon capture technologies, and investigating alternative binders. The broader use of these practices requires regulatory incentives , construction engagement, and greater knowledge among engineers about the environmental benefits and possible financial advantages associated with low-carbon concrete.

Cement-Free Concrete: India's Path to Eco-Friendly Infrastructure

India, confronting the environmental burden of traditional concrete production, is increasingly exploring cement-free concrete as a key solution. This innovative material eliminates Portland cement with alternative binders like fly ash, slag, and calcined clay , drastically lowering the emissions associated with construction. The authorities is encouraging research and use of these technologies, recognizing their potential to contribute to a eco-conscious building landscape. Moreover , cement-free concrete offers improved durability and characteristics in certain applications, enabling it a promising option for India's burgeoning infrastructure projects .
